Newspaper Front Page & Page 2 - Advertisement Research

I have learned through my newspaper research that all newspapers feature image adverts about local businesses and products. I will use a selection of businesses from the Hedingham area, and I will create a series of adverts linking to this.

Advertisements in newspapers tend to be in a rectangular-box form, or in the form of a horizontal / vertical banner, depends on how the newspaper pages are structured out. These will advertise companies in the local area, or advertise events which will be held in these businesses.

If I use adverts that revolve around events, I will choose events that I have included in my website (task). This can help show continuity between my products.
